Light bulbs transform electrical energy to light energy. no energy transformation is 100%. thus, in the transfer from electrical energy to light energy, some energy is dissipated as heat. the efficiency of an electrical device depends on: 1. how much energy is wasted ‐ transferred to unwanted stores 2. how much energy is transferred to useful stores the more energy a device wastes, the less efficient it is. the graph shows the efficiency of three types of light bulbs: incandescent, fluorescent, and led. what can you conclude about the energy efficiency of the light bulbs?
